Near B gates, Shades is the airport sunglasses stop

Shades sits in Terminal B at El Paso International Airport (ELP), on the post-security concourse used for several mainline departures. It’s a small, focused shop built around sunglasses and related accessories, useful if you forgot yours before a desert flight into or out of El Paso.

The name is literal: Shades mainly sells sunglasses, with brands and styles changing over time based on airport retail contracts. Expect typical airport pricing at a premium over off-airport stores; think full MSRP rather than outlet deals. Inventory usually skews toward travel basics rather than fashion one-offs, so you can replace a broken pair quickly before boarding.

Terminal B at ELP tends to handle a mix of American and United flights, so Shades is handy if your boarding pass shows a B-gate number. Use it as a last-minute stop between security and gates, not as a destination you cross terminals for. There’s no public information on exact hours, but shops here typically match first-morning departures and close after the last evening bank.

Plan five extra minutes into your walk to the B gates if you think you’ll browse. If your sunglasses are fine and your layover is under 40 minutes, skip it and head straight to your gate instead.
